[docs]def dump(obj, fp=None, indent=None, sort_keys=False, **kw):
"""
Dump object to a file like object or string.
:param obj:
:param fp: Open file like object
:param int indent: Indent size, default 2
:param bool sort_keys: Optionally sort dictionary keys.
:return: Yaml serialized data.
"""
if fp:
iterable = YAMLEncoder(indent=indent, sort_keys=sort_keys, **kw).iterencode(obj)
for chunk in iterable:
fp.write(chunk)
else:
return dumps(obj, indent=indent, sort_keys=sort_keys, **kw)
[docs]def dumps(obj, indent=None, default=None, sort_keys=False, **kw):
"""Dump string."""
return YAMLEncoder(indent=indent, default=default, sort_keys=sort_keys, **kw).encode(obj)
[docs]def load(s, **kwargs):
"""Load yaml file"""
try:
return loads(s, **kwargs)
except TypeError:
return loads(s.read(), **kwargs)
[docs]def loads(s, cls=None, **kwargs):
"""Load string"""
if not isinstance(s, string_types):
raise TypeError('the YAML object must be str, not {0!r}'.format(s.__class__.__name__))
cls = cls or YAMLDecoder
return cls(**kwargs).decode(s)
